A Professional Certificate in Health Research for Technicians equips participants with the essential skills and knowledge needed to thrive in the dynamic field of health research. This program focuses on practical application, bridging the gap between theoretical knowledge and real-world scenarios encountered in a clinical research setting.
Learning outcomes for this certificate program include proficiency in data management, statistical analysis relevant to healthcare, regulatory compliance in clinical trials, and effective communication of research findings. Graduates will be adept at utilizing research methodologies, including data collection techniques and ethical considerations within health research projects.
The duration of the Professional Certificate in Health Research for Technicians typically ranges from several months to a year, depending on the program's intensity and structure. Many programs offer flexible scheduling options to accommodate working professionals seeking career advancement or upskilling opportunities.
This certificate holds significant industry relevance, preparing graduates for various roles within the healthcare sector. Graduates are well-prepared for positions as research assistants, clinical trial coordinators, or data analysts in hospitals, pharmaceutical companies, and research institutions. The program’s focus on biostatistics and clinical research methodology makes it highly valuable in today’s competitive job market.
The strong emphasis on practical skills, combined with the program's alignment with industry standards and best practices, ensures graduates are immediately employable and ready to contribute meaningfully to health research projects. The program may also serve as a stepping stone for further education in related fields, such as public health or epidemiology.
